Essential Duties

Avanos is seeking an R&D Engineer III to support the design, development, testing, documentation, and commercialization of single time use medical devices and related products across the Avanos portfolio.

The role will focus on translating product and user needs into practical engineering requirements, developing robust disposable-device designs, planning and executing engineering testing, and maintaining clear and traceable design-control documentation.

The engineer will work closely with Quality, Regulatory, Systems Engineering, Technical Operations, Manufacturing, suppliers, and external development partners throughout the product development lifecycle.

Responsibilities
  • Contribute to and lead the development of disposable and single-use medical devices, including products that interface with reusable equipment or electromechanical systems, from feasibility through commercialization.
  • Translate user needs, product requirements, risk controls, and manufacturing needs into clear and measurable engineering requirements and design outputs.
  • Develop and refine disposable medical device designs using sound mechanical engineering principles, including 3D CAD models, engineering drawings, component specifications, assembly specifications, and tolerance analyses.
  • Apply Design for Manufacturing and Assembly principles to develop products that are reliable, cost-effective, scalable, and suitable for commercial production.
  • Support material and process selection for disposable medical device components, including molded and extruded polymers, tubing, adhesives, bonding processes, films, seals, and packaging interfaces.
  • Collaborate with suppliers, contract manufacturers, external test laboratories, and Technical Operations teams to evaluate manufacturability, tooling, assembly processes, process capability, production readiness, and externally generated engineering deliverables.
  • Plan, execute, and document engineering testing, including feasibility, design characterization, comparative, prototype evaluation, verification, reliability, simulated-use, design-change verification, and failure investigation testing.
  • Develop and review test methods, fixtures, protocols, data sheets, acceptance criteria, and test reports to ensure testing is repeatable, reliable, technically accurate, and aligned with approved requirements.
  • Lead or support prototype builds, engineering builds, pilot builds, and product evaluations, including documentation of build configurations, test article conditions, component revisions, and manufacturing processes.
  • Investigate prototype, design, manufacturing, and test failures using structured root-cause analysis and technical problem-solving methods.
  • Generate and maintain Design History File documentation, including design inputs and outputs, specifications, drawings, design reviews, risk-management documentation, verification and validation records, traceability, engineering analyses, and design-change documentation.
  • Lead or support risk-management activities, including hazard analyses, Design FMEAs, identification of risk controls, and verification of risk-control effectiveness.
  • Support sterilization, packaging, transportation, shelf-life, aging, and biocompatibility activities by providing product requirements, test samples, engineering assessments, and technical documentation.
  • Collaborate with Quality, Regulatory, Systems Engineering, Clinical, Marketing, Technical Operations, Manufacturing, and project leadership to ensure product and project requirements are understood and addressed.
  • Mentor junior engineers in medical device design, engineering testing, design controls, technical documentation, and structured problem solving.
